    <title>Preferential Treatment for Status Holders</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/circulars?id=53507</link>
    <description>Preferential treatment for Status Holders under the Foreign Trade Policy 2015-20 requires Regional Authorities to give priority and expedited, time bound processing of electronic advance authorisation applications and related amendments, including revalidation and invalidation, in accordance with Para 3.24(g) and the Handbook of Procedure Para 9.10; RAs must follow the prescribed shortened timelines scrupulously when disposing applications from Status Holders.</description>
